What Is Couples Therapy?
Couples therapy, commonly referred to as couples counseling, is a specialized form of psychotherapy aimed at assisting partners in confronting and resolving their relationship challenges. This therapeutic approach seeks to address a range of issues, including physical intimacy, communication difficulties, emotional withdrawal, and trust concerns and infidelity issues that may develop over time, often as a result of conflicts related to physical intimacy or other dimensions of their relational dynamics.
Through the implementation of effective therapeutic methodologies, couples can cultivate problem-solving skills that promote a healthier relationship, thereby enhancing their overall relationship satisfaction. Esteemed therapists such as John Gottman and Julie Gottman, renowned experts in relationship science, have made substantial contributions to this field, employing distinctive therapeutic techniques to facilitate the reconstruction of the psychological bond between couples, crucial for a healthy relationship.

What Are the Different Types of Couples Therapy?
There are various types of couples therapy designed to address different relationship dynamics and concerns, each utilizing distinct therapy techniques and therapeutic approaches to assist couples in enhancing their emotional connection.
Emotion-Focused Therapy (EFT) aims to improve emotional intimacy by addressing underlying issues related to emotional withdrawal and trust. Cognitive Behavioral Therapy (CBT) focuses on altering negative thought patterns that contribute to communication difficulties and relationship problems. Imago Relationship Therapy assists couples in understanding the impact of childhood influences and relational patterns often seen in marriage.
Additionally, Solution-Focused Therapy equips couples with the tools necessary to identify their goals and solutions within a brief time frame, thereby facilitating more effective resolution of issues such as infidelity and conflict.
Emotionally Focused Therapy (EFT)
Emotionally Focused Therapy (EFT) is a highly effective approach to couples therapy that aims to enhance emotional intimacy and address trust issues within relationships, similar to marriage counseling. This method assists partners in identifying their emotional responses and interaction patterns, enabling them to reconnect on a deeper level through the acknowledgment and expression of their feelings.
At its foundation, EFT underscores the importance of establishing a safe emotional environment where both partners can explore their vulnerabilities without fear of judgment. This process not only facilitates individuals in articulating their needs but also fosters empathy towards their partner’s experiences, improving their empathy development.

Increased Understanding and Empathy
Couples therapy significantly enhances understanding and empathy between partners, enabling them to connect on a deeper emotional level. By facilitating discussions regarding each partner’s feelings and experiences, therapy promotes emotional intimacy and assists couples in effectively addressing trust issues.
Through structured exercises and guided conversations, therapy establishes a safe environment for individuals to express vulnerable emotions, which is essential for fostering empathy. For example, a common exercise involves partners taking turns articulating their feelings while the other listens attentively without interruption. This practice not only enhances mutual understanding but also equips partners with the skills to respond with compassion rather than defensiveness.
Another effective technique may involve role-reversal, where partners assume each other’s perspectives to gain insight into one another’s emotional needs. Additionally, sharing personal narratives about challenging experiences can play a crucial role in this process, aiding both partners in recognizing and appreciating the emotional impact of each other’s life events.
As partners engage in these exercises, they frequently observe significant improvements in communication and emotional support within their relationship, ultimately resulting in increased satisfaction and a stronger connection.
Resolving Conflicts and Issues
Another significant benefit of couples therapy, including Emotion-Focused Therapy and Imago Relationship Therapy, lies in its emphasis on addressing conflicts and issues that may jeopardize the relationship. Therapists provide couples with conflict resolution strategies that facilitate constructive navigation of disagreements, thereby minimizing emotional distance and fostering a deeper connection.
By employing various techniques such as active listening, reframing, and compromise, therapists assist individuals in gaining insight into each other’s perspectives. For example, a couple experiencing communication difficulties may utilize these tools to articulate their needs more effectively while also attentively considering their partner’s concerns. Common relationship challenges, including jealousy, financial strain, and differing parenting styles, can be effectively addressed through these methods.
- Jealousy: Therapists promote open discussions to reveal underlying fears and insecurities.
- Financial Stress: Strategies may encompass joint budgeting and discussions regarding values.
- Differing Parenting Styles: Techniques focus on establishing common ground and shared objectives.
Ultimately, the effective resolution of conflicts can lead to a more fulfilling relationship characterized by trust and mutual respect.

When Is Couples Counseling Not Effective?
Couples therapy may not yield positive outcomes in certain circumstances, particularly when one or both partners are unwilling to engage in the therapeutic process or when significant relationship issues, such as emotional distance or trust concerns, remain unaddressed. In situations involving severe psychological distress or abuse, alternative interventions may be necessary.
If one partner is facing unresolved personal issues, such as mental health challenges or past traumas, this may impede their ability to fully participate in therapy. A lack of commitment from either party can hinder even the most skilled therapist’s efforts to facilitate meaningful progress.
Moreover,
- Severe emotional withdrawal can obstruct open communication, making it difficult to rebuild intimacy.
- If trust issues persist, couples may struggle to be vulnerable with one another, resulting in further disconnection.
These factors highlight the importance of couples assessing their readiness for therapy. In certain cases, seeking individual therapy or support groups may prove to be more advantageous. Recognizing when traditional couples therapy may not be sufficient is essential in the journey toward healing, as it ensures that partners effectively address both their relationship dynamics and individual challenges.
